The ULB Experimentarium is a unique museum dedicated to the teaching of Physics. Physical principles are illustrated through classic experiments, often narrated by trained personnel who guide the audience with a gentle didactic teaching technique. Some of the experiments include the freefall of feathers and lead through air and vacuum, gyroscopic balance, and the mysteries of the seance table. Phone: +32 / 02 6505618
